A project i've been working on lately
the signal goes in a SHO first then to an effect send (put your favorite OD here) then effect return then another SHO stage the your amp.
Since putting a boost before your OD will most probably only get you more gain an no volume increase,
I've build this to get more gain and more volume in one pedal click
the two boost are engaged at the same time in a true bypass way by the 2 dpdt relays.
(I know putting a boost before some OD like the zendrive will increase the volume also, put with my Catalinbread clone it only gave me more gain)
